The job market in Old Greenwich, Connecticut

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Old Greenwich, CT.

Old Greenwich is home to a range of thriving industries that cater to various professional interests. The finance sector offers ample job opportunities in this city, with technology and science companies also playing significant roles in the region's economic landscape. For those passionate about contributing to health care services, they can find career satisfaction in the numerous facilities available. Retail businesses and educational institutions are other prominent fields that provide employment prospects for job seekers, ensuring that Old Greenwich remains an ideal location for individuals from all walks of life.

In the city, employment opportunities are accompanied by a relatively high average salary, which is 86.59% above the national average at $129,168 per year. The majority of people in this metropolitan area, approximately 71%, receive their insurance coverage through their employers. However, it is important to note that the cost of living here is considerably higher than the national median, with an index reflecting a 150.0% increase. Additionally, residents often experience a commute time averaging around 38 minutes.

In Old Greenwich, Connecticut, the unemployment rate is currently at 8.20%, which is above the national average of 3.8%.
